ANN ARBOR (WTVB) – The Michigan-Michigan State rivalry resumes tonight at Crisler Center where the host Wolverines hope to use MSU to stop a stop a 4 game losing streak. The Spartans secured a much needed win at home Saturday over Ohio State to bolster their chances of getting a bid to the NCAA Tournament. Michigan is a longshot to make the big dance but they’ve beaten the Spartans on MSU’s last 4 visits to Ann Arbor and less than a month ago the Wolverines took Michigan State into overtime before losing at the Breslin Center.
